This couple came legally. They applied for asylum before their visas expired, wanting to do it all by the books. After six months, they applied for work permits to stay afloat, passing background checks. They worked legally and paid taxes while government delay dragged on. Then ICE came for them.

The couple quickly became key to Chicago’s nightlife, curating events and performing in some of Chicago’s most popular venues. They were getting ready for their biggest venture yet: following Karol G’s tour across the country, hosting unofficial afterparties.
But on Sunday morning, as the couple walked out of their rideshare outside of Midway Airport, they were apprehended by federal immigration agents. The two were on their way to take a flight to Washington, D.C., the first stop of the tour. They never made it through the door.
The Department of Homeland Security said it had arrested Panqueva, 26, and Paez, 27, for overstaying their visas, which both expired in 2022. But their attorney, Enrique Espinoza, said the pair had applied for asylum within the required time frame before their visas expired. The two both have asylum cases, Social Security numbers, work permits and the documents required for their ongoing legal process, Espinoza said.
